Description
Located in the desirable, sought out village of Failand, this is a unique and versatile home. Presented to the market for the first time since 2004, the current owner transformed it in 2016 to provide a spacious, main home with a substantial, independent annexe.Approaching the property, the drive offers parking for up to six cars, and has an attractive front garden, with evergreen shrubs and Maple trees. The main house opens into a large double height hall with a huge chandelier that leads through to open plan living/dining/kitchen with bi fold doors onto the rear garden, adjoining utility room and completed by a generous study and a downstairs WC. Upstairs are 5 double bedrooms, three of which have built in wardrobes and one a walk in closet and two with en-suite shower rooms and a large family bathroom.

The annex, accessed via its own front door leads into a welcoming hallway leading into a fully fitted kitchen, with ceiling lantern and utility room, living room, dining room and large family bathroom. Upstairs there are three double bedrooms and family shower room. The houses are connected via an internal door upstairs.At the rear of the house is a generous patio area offering access from both the main house and annex, with both steps and a slope down to a mature, attractive garden mostly laid to lawn with a variety of plants, including roses, shrubs and small trees. Fully enclosed with side access from the driveway.

This property offers a rare opportunity for potential buyers to acquire a substantial home. Currently established as two homes, with the annex set up as a successful airbnb or offering multi generational accommodation, it would also be possible, with necessary planning permission, to modify the house into one home or indeed convert it into two dwellings with no connecting door.
Location
Surrounded by rolling countryside, Failand is a sought after semi-rural small village that lies just a short distance south-west from Bristol City Centre and cosmopolitan Clifton Village. Fabulous country walks are easily accessed and it is close to two well respected golf courses and the beautiful Ashton Court Estate with its deer park and acres of open space ideal for walking, cycling or riding is within easy reach. There is a popular Public House serving good quality food, a village shop and village hall. Easy access to the M5 at J19 gives excellent transport links with an abundant choice of excellent schooling (both state and private) within the vicinity.
